Hermes Kanban Mini App
Telegram Mini App and web dashboard for Hermes Agent Kanban boards. View, create, and manage tasks from mobile or desktop.
What it does
- Board view: Kanban columns — triage, todo, ready, running, blocked, done, archived
- Task details: body, events, runs, log tail, comments
- Task actions: create, assign, promote, block/unblock, archive, dispatch, comment
- Telegram integration: Mini App theme variables,
initDataauth, haptic feedback - Secure bridge: execFile with
shell: false, command allowlist, token auth
Architecture
Telegram Mini App / Browser
│
│ HTTPS / Vite proxy in dev
▼
React + TypeScript + Vite frontend (port 5173 dev / 80 nginx)
│
│ /bridge/v1/* (X-Bridge-Token or dev mode)
▼
Express Bridge (port 3456)
│
│ hermes kanban ... --json (execFile, shell: false)
▼
Hermes Kanban board (SQLite)
Monorepo structure (pnpm workspace):
packages/contracts— shared TypeScript types + Zod schemaspackages/bridge— Express API server, CLI wrapperfrontend— React + Vite SPA with Tailwind CSS
Quick start
Prerequisites
- Node.js ≥ 18
- pnpm 9.x (
corepack enable) - Hermes Agent installed with Kanban enabled
Local development
git clone https://github.com/Kisskin-Mister/hermes-kanban-miniapp.git
cd hermes-kanban-miniapp
cp .env.example .env # edit as needed
pnpm install
make dev # starts bridge + frontend
- Frontend: http://localhost:5173 (Vite dev server with hot reload)
- Bridge API: http://localhost:3456/bridge/v1/health
Docker Compose
cp .env.example .env # edit HERMES_HOME, BRIDGE_TOKEN, etc.
make docker-build # or: docker compose build
make up # or: docker compose up -d
- Frontend: http://localhost:8080
- Bridge API: http://localhost:3456 (internal, proxied by nginx)
Production
make build # build TypeScript
make docker-build # build images
make up # start containers
The docker-compose.yml mounts ~/.hermes read-only into the bridge container. Configure HERMES_HOME in .env.
Environment variables
Bridge (.env)
| Variable | Default | Description |
|---|---|---|
BRIDGE_HOST |
127.0.0.1 |
Bridge bind address |
BRIDGE_PORT |
8787 |
Bridge port |
BRIDGE_TOKEN |
— | Auth token (X-Bridge-Token header) |
AUTH_MODE |
token |
token (validate header) or dev (bypass auth) |
BRIDGE_ALLOWED_BOARDS |
default |
Comma-separated board slugs or * |
COMMAND_TIMEOUT_SECONDS |
30 |
Per-command timeout |
LOG_TAIL_MAX_LINES |
500 |
Max log lines returned |
HERMES_BIN |
hermes |
Path to hermes executable |
HERMES_HOME |
— | Hermes profile directory |
TELEGRAM_BOT_TOKEN |
— | For initData validation (optional) |

Makefile commands
make install — pnpm install
make dev — run bridge + frontend in dev mode
make build — build all TypeScript packages
make typecheck — run TypeScript type checking
make test — run bridge tests
make ci — install + typecheck + test + build
make docker-build — build Docker images
make up — docker compose up -d
make down — docker compose down
make logs — follow service logs
make clean — remove build artifacts
Telegram Mini App setup
- Create a bot with BotFather
- Set the Mini App domain:
/setdomain→ your HTTPS domain - Configure
.env:AUTH_MODE=token BRIDGE_TOKEN=<generate-a-strong-token> TELEGRAM_BOT_TOKEN=<your-bot-token> - Deploy with HTTPS (Caddy, Nginx, Traefik, or Cloudflare Tunnel)
CI
Forgejo CI workflow (.forgejo/workflows/test.yml) runs on push to main:
- Typecheck contracts, bridge, frontend
- Run bridge unit tests (vitest)
- Build frontend
